Scholarship Overview
This scholarship is for entering or returning undergraduate students enrolled full-time (at least 12 hours) at an accredited undergraduate US institution. To qualify for this scholarship, applicants must be permanent residents of a New England state: Connecticut, Maine, Massachusetts, New Hampshire, Rhode Island, or Vermont. Applicants must be studying for an undergraduate degree for the first time, be US citizens or resident aliens, and demonstrate financial need. Applicants must demonstrate academic excellence with a 3.0 GPA, be enrolled in a demanding course of study, and demonstrate skilled writing ability. Applicants must also demonstrate citizenship, character, and serious-mindedness; demonstrate a desire to make a meaningful contribution to society both present and future; be involved in a balance of community, school, and work activities; pursue goals and aspirations with integrity, resolution, self-discipline, and judgment; and earn money for college expenses through part-time work.
